Patterns for Modelling and Composing Flexible Workflows from Cloud Services Topics: Model Driven Architectures and Engineering; Modeling of Distributed Systems In Proceedings of the 20th International Conference on Enterprise Information Systems - Volume 1: ICEIS, 306-313, 2018 , Funchal, Madeira, Portugal